This document describes the modules, frameworks, and key data/audio/AI flows.
The architectural lever: Apple Watch is the tracker; iPhone is the brain. All custom GPS/distance/pace/HR/auto-pause/splits code is replaced by HKWorkoutSession + HKLiveWorkoutBuilder on the watch. The phone consumes a stream of authoritative metrics over WatchConnectivity and uses them to drive the AI script engine and TTS playback.

Worth being explicit, because this is where the schedule savings come from:
- ❌ CoreLocation handling. No
CLLocationManager. No accuracy filtering, no smoothing, no auto-pause heuristics. - ❌ Distance integration. No Haversine. No moving averages.
- ❌ Pace computation. Watch publishes current and average pace.
- ❌ Splits computation. Watch publishes split events.
- ❌ Heart rate sampling. Watch publishes HR ticks at the system's sample rate.
- ❌ Calorie estimation. Apple does it.
- ❌ Indoor vs outdoor distance estimation.
HKWorkoutSessionconfig picks the right algo. - ❌ Background GPS reliability scaffolding on the phone. The phone does not need to record location.
- ❌ Pedometer fallback. Watch handles indoor running.
We do write: the watch app's session host, the WatchConnectivity wiring, the script engine, TTS pipeline, AI client, memory layer, and the iOS UI.

The only place an HKWorkoutSession is created. Owns the workout lifecycle.
- Starts session with
HKWorkoutConfiguration(activityType: .running, locationType: .outdoor or .indoor). - Begins
HKLiveWorkoutBuildercollection — Apple automatically populates distance, energy, HR, pace. - For outdoor runs: also starts
HKWorkoutRouteBuilderand feeds it locations fromCLLocationManager(still on the watch — but Apple's running-mode location config does the smoothing). - Polls or observes the
builder.statistics(for:)API on a 1Hz timer to publish live metrics to the phone. - On end:
endCollection,finishWorkout, write route, hand the workout UUID to the phone.

Subscribes to WCSession messages from the watch.
- Receives 1Hz
LiveMetrics. Stores latest snapshot in an@Observablestate object that the UI binds to. - Forwards every snapshot to
ScriptEngine. - Tracks connection liveness; if no metrics for 10s while supposedly running, surfaces a "watch disconnected" indicator (does not stop the run — the watch keeps recording).
Read-only on the phone. The watch is the writer.
- Read scope: workouts, distance, HR, energy, route.
- Used to render History (list of past
HKWorkouts of activity.running). - Used to render Trends (HKStatisticsCollectionQuery for weekly mileage, etc.).
- Resolves workout UUIDs → our local
Runcompanion record (Script, voice notes, etc.).
The phone may request HealthKit write permissions only as a fallback to write companion-only metadata (a workout's metadata dictionary holds our runId so we can link). We do NOT write a duplicate workout from the phone.

The thing that turns "runner is at 5.2km, on pace, HR 168" into "play this line now".
- Holds the active
Scriptfor the run (an ordered list ofScriptMessages with triggers). - On each
LiveMetricstick (1Hz), evaluates triggers and dispatches at most one message per ~30s window. - Trigger types:
distance.atMeters,distance.everyMeters,time.atSeconds,halfway,near_finish,condition(whitelisted expression),fatigue_zone. - When async AI replies arrive (Phase 2), slots them at the next safe trigger point.
Single entry point for any LLM call.
- Methods:
generateScript(plan:),chatReply(transcript:context:),postRunSummary(run:). - Caches responses; replays from cache for retried requests.
- Persistent retry queue (in SwiftData) for offline scenarios; drains on connectivity restore.
- Timeouts: 8s for chat-reply (else fall back to a stock line), 30s for script generation, 60s for post-run summary.

- Configure on app launch:
.playback/.spokenAudio/[.mixWithOthers, .duckOthers]. - Activate only while a run is active.
- When TTS speaks, the system ducks Apple Music / Spotify / Podcasts.
- 200ms grace silence pre/post utterance for clean duck-in/duck-out.
- Listen for
AVAudioSessionInterruptionNotification; pause on.began, resume on.endedwithshouldResume.
Tested against Apple Music, Spotify, Podcasts, Audible — all honour the audio session contract.
The phone is the audio device. Required UIBackgroundModes on iOS:
audio— keeps TTS playable when locked.fetch— occasional script regeneration, rare.
We do NOT need location background mode on the phone — the watch is the location/workout host.
The watch's HKWorkoutSession keeps its app foregrounded for the duration of the workout. Standard.

Live metrics are best-effort 1Hz; missed ticks are fine because the watch is independently writing to HealthKit. Workout state events use transferUserInfo (queued, guaranteed delivery).

The proxy prepends a per-personality system prompt. Prompt caching keeps costs low for the stable prefix (personality + memory + recent runs) across calls.
- UI on main actor.
LiveMetricsConsumerruns on a WC delegate queue; forwards to MainActor.AudioPlaybackManager,AIClient,WorkoutSessionHost(watch) are actors.ModelContainershared; writes on a backgroundModelContext.
One writer per concern, no shared mutable state outside actors.
